Which of the following is an intervention that can be used with premature infants in the NICU?

Explanation:
Entrainment is the process of aligning music with another rhythm to influence the body’s rhythms. In the NICU with premature infants, their autonomic systems are still maturing, so using a steady, heartbeat-like tempo helps their breathing and heart rate synchronize with the musical input. This rhythmic alignment can calm the infant, stabilize arousal, support more organized sleep–wake cycles, and improve feeding readiness. The approach is typically delivered with live singing or soft, regular sounds, carefully monitored for cues from the infant so tempo and texture can be adjusted as needed. Improvising with the infant is a broader interactive method, but entrainment specifically targets physiological regulation through rhythmic synchronization, and lyric analysis isn’t appropriate for such young clients.
